Note the unemployment rate when each took office: 7.5% for Reagan in January 1981, 7.8% for Obama in January 2009. It peaked for Reagan at 10.8% in November of 1982, while getting no higher than 10% for Obama (it was originally 10.2%, but has since been revised).
By September of their respective reelection years, the rate had fallen to 7.3% for Reagan, and now 7.8% for Obama.
